The Preconscious, Conscious, and Unconscious Minds
Freud's Three Levels of Mind Freud delineated the mind in distinct levels, each with their roles and functions. The preconscious consists of anything that could potentially be brought into the conscious mind. The conscious mind contains all of the thoughts, memories, feelings, and wishes of which we are aware at any given moment. Silencing Inner Critic
The critical inner voice is a well-integrated pattern of destructive thoughts toward ourselves and others. The nagging “voices,” or thoughts, that make up this internalised dialogue are at the root of much of our self-destructive and maladaptive behaviour. The critical inner voice is not an auditory hallucination; it is experienced as thoughts within your head. Healing Toxic Patterns Breaking Trauma Bonds
Defining Trauma Bonds A trauma bond is a psychological response to abuse, typically found in certain interpersonal relationships. It emerges from a repeated cycle of hurtful behavior followed by moments of affection. This cyclical nature generates a powerful attachment between the victim and their abuser.
